Have no fear the U.S. Department of Commerce's National Institute of Standards and Technology (NIST) has selected four quantum-resistant cryptographic algorithms for general encryption and digital signatures to defend modern computing.

85131ce81e0cbc62aaf08d2403da82e89eea5f116702d8f85fd6536e97b6850b.png

What has taken place? NIST has taken the past 6-years to evaluate quantum resistant (AKA QR) alternatives. 

They reviewed cryptographic algorithms for:

  • Digital signatures,
  • Key exchange,
  • Public key encryption

What are today's approved standards?

  • Key algorithms include AES-256 for symmetric key encryption, S
  • HA-256 and SHA-3 for hashing functions,
  • RSA public key encryption for digital signatures and key establishment,
  • Elliptic Curve Cryptography (ECDSA, ECDH) and DSA public key encryption for digital signatures and key exchange.

 What has been selected for a post-quantum world?

  • CRYSTALS-Kyber algorithm for general encryption

What else has NIST considered for post-quantum world?

  • CRYSTALS-Dilithium,
  • FALCON 
  • SPHINCS+ for post-quantum digital signatures.

Together these four algorithms make up post-quantum standards

  • CRYSTALS-Kyber algorithm for general encryption
  • CRYSTALS-Dilithium,
  • FALCON 
  • SPHINCS+ for post-quantum digital signatures.

Timeframe -  NIST expects the new set of public-key cryptography standards by 2024.
